Buy Magic Mushrooms Online St.John's, Canada

Buy the highest quality lowest priced magic mushrooms in St. John’s, Canada

Premium Magic Mushrooms St. John's, Canada

St. John’s is a city located in Newfoundland. Great deals, top-notch strains, and amazing magic mushroom products – all of these from the most reputable Canadian manufacturers who grow their plants in an organic way. If you do a shroom trip in St. John’s be sure to check out Shea Heights Lookout. Signal Hill National Park, Cape Spear Lighthouse and King’s Beach.

Featured Products